What’s the difference between “Shared” hosting and a “Dedicated” Server?

0

Shared hosting is when several customers’ websites are hosted on one server or machine. A dedicated server is when you are the only customer on the server. You have full control over the server, and you can place as many websites on it as you like. The only websites on your dedicated server are yours. Most individuals use shared hosting, since it’s much more affordable for those just starting out. However, shared doesn’t mean other people can access your code or tamper with your files or anything. It just means that, behind the scenes, other websites are being hosted on the same server, but only you with have access to your website files. Read more about hosting.
